What United States pricing must separate

U.S. sellers checking China-to-USA shipping mode, CBM, landed cost, HTS, 3PL/FBA prep and product risk before supplier payment.

Supplier price is not landed cost

The visible 1688 price still needs HTS classification, de minimis uncertainty, agency-sensitive products, claim language, and 3PL prep, package data, and supplier confirmation before it can support a quote.

Service work stays visible

Product check, supplier review, assisted ordering, warehouse evidence, prep, labels, repack, and shipping review should not be hidden inside the product price.

Quote controls purchase

Supplymo should not buy from the supplier until the buyer has reviewed the quote, risk notes, and payment requirement.

What should I send before requesting a quote?

Send the product link or image, quantity, variants, destination, sales channel, package data if available, prep needs, and anything known about HTS clues, packed size, carton weight, claim wording, and warehouse photo proof.

What usually changes the result for United States?

HTS classification, de minimis uncertainty, agency-sensitive products, claim language, and 3PL prep can change whether the product should move to quote, sample first, manual review, or stop before supplier payment.
